Workswell WIRIS Enterprise Thermal Camera with Gremsy Pixy WE Gimbal: Radiometric Imaging to 1,500°C for the IF1200A
The Workswell WIRIS Enterprise Thermal Camera with Gremsy Pixy WE Gimbal turns a single IF1200A flight into a complete inspection dataset, pairing a radiometric thermal camera with two RGB cameras and a laser rangefinder on one stabilized platform.
Each captured scene generates five separate images automatically: high-resolution thermal, high-resolution visible, a controller screenshot, an optical zoom frame, and a standard IR image, so a single pass covers what would otherwise take multiple sensor swaps.
Key Features and Benefits
- Radiometric thermal camera: captures 640x512 imaging up to 1500 degrees Celsius
- Super resolution mode: enhances thermal images to 1.3 megapixel resolution
- 30x optical zoom: identifies distant targets without closing physical distance
- 16MP fixed camera: captures high resolution imagery for mapping documentation
- Laser rangefinder: measures target distance accurately up to 1500 meters
- Rugged IP66 rating: withstands dust, rain, and pressurized water jets
- Stabilized Pixy WE gimbal: keeps footage smooth during active flight
- WIRIS OS control: streams real time data during every flight
- Calibrated thermal lens: ensures accurate temperature readings for research work
- ThermoLab software included: analyzes thermal data with detailed reporting tools

Compatibility and System Integration
- IF1200A airframe: connects via MavLink through flight controller (sold separately)
- Gremsy Pixy WE gimbal: arrives fully integrated and mounted (included)
- Hard transport case: protects the full payload during travel (included)
- Rugged payload case: houses the camera for field storage (included)
- Micro SD card: provides additional storage for image capture (included)
- ThermoLab software license: enables full radiometric analysis on desktop (included)
- Gremsy T3V3 gimbal: offers an alternate mounting option (sold separately)
